Comparison Summary

1. Specifications Comparison

Featurevivo V29Xiaomi Redmi 13C 5GPractical Impact
Design
Dimensions164.2 x 74.4 x 7.5 mm168 x 78 x 8.1 mmRedmi 13C is noticeably larger and thicker. V29 is more pocketable and comfortable for one-handed use.
Weight186g192gV29 is slightly lighter, contributing to a more premium feel and easier handling.
FingerprintUnder DisplaySide-mountedUnder-display fingerprint sensors generally feel more modern and premium compared to side-mounted ones.
Display
Display TypeAMOLED, 1B colors, 120HzIPS LCD, 90HzV29 offers significantly better contrast, deeper blacks, and more vibrant colors. Its higher refresh rate ensures smoother scrolling.
Resolution1260 x 2800720 x 1600V29 has a much sharper and more detailed display. Redmi 13C's display will appear pixelated in comparison.
Refresh Rate120Hz90HzV29 offers smoother animations and scrolling.
Performance
ChipsetSnapdragon 778G 5G (6 nm)Dimensity 6100+ (6 nm)Both offer comparable mid-range performance, though specific benchmarks would be needed for a definitive comparison.
CPUOcta-core (1x2.4 GHz...)Octa-core (2x2.2 GHz...)Similar performance, but detailed benchmarks are necessary for precise comparison.
GPUAdreno 642LMali-G57 MC2Gaming performance likely favors the Adreno 642L, but real-world testing is needed.
RAM8GB6GBV29's extra RAM enables better multitasking and smoother performance with multiple apps open.
Storage256GB128GBV29 offers double the storage, allowing for more apps, photos, and videos.
Camera
Video Capabilities4K@30fps, 1080p@30fps1080p@30fpsV29 can record video in higher resolution (4K).
Battery
Capacity4600 mAh5000 mAhRedmi 13C has a larger battery capacity, potentially offering longer battery life.

2. Key Differences Analysis

vivo V29 Advantages:

  • Superior Display: AMOLED with higher resolution, refresh rate, and color accuracy. This translates to a significantly better visual experience for media consumption, gaming, and everyday use.
  • More Premium Design: Slimmer, lighter, with an under-display fingerprint sensor. Feels more modern and high-end.
  • Double the Storage: 256GB provides ample space for apps, photos, and videos.
  • Higher Resolution Video Recording: 4K video recording capability.

Xiaomi Redmi 13C 5G Advantages:

  • Larger Battery: 5000 mAh battery potentially provides longer battery life.
  • Potentially Lower Price: While both are mid-range, the Redmi 13C is likely more affordable.

3. User Profiles & Recommendations

vivo V29: Users who prioritize display quality, premium design, ample storage, and smooth performance. Suitable for media consumption, gaming, photography, and general use.

Xiaomi Redmi 13C 5G: Users who prioritize battery life and affordability above all else. Best for basic tasks like calling, texting, browsing, and light media consumption.

4. Decision Framework

Key Questions for Buyers:

  1. How important is display quality? If a vibrant and sharp display is a priority, the V29 is the clear winner.
  2. What is your budget? The Redmi 13C likely offers better value if price is the primary concern.
  3. What is your typical usage? Heavy users who multitask and consume lots of media would benefit from the V29's performance and storage. Light users might find the Redmi 13C sufficient.
